Count Ceprano held up, headway 3f out, ridden to lead inside final furlong, ran on well
Red Romeo led early, always prominent, led 2f out, ridden and headed inside final furlong, one pace
Harare held up, steady headway over 5f out, ridden well over 1f out, hung left inside final furlong, one pace
Westport held up, ridden and headway over 1f out, one pace final furlong
Teen Ager held up in rear, ridden and headway on outside well over 1f out, one pace final furlong
H Harrison soon led, ridden and headed 2f out, weakened over 1f out
Inch Lodge soon prominent, ridden and weakened over 3f out
Byron Bay soon chasing leader, weakened 3f out
Divertimenti held up, short-lived effort over 2f out, eased over 1f out
Red Romeo, who had raced alone up the near side when well beaten at Doncaster last weekend, was back to his best form here. However, he found the concession of weight all round beyond him and the handicapper probably has his measure at present.
Harare, who had hung left when third over 1m here last time, did so again this time and he remains a somewhat quirky individual. However, he was by no means disgraced, especially as he is currently racing off a mark higher than he has ever won off.
Byron Bay seems to have two ways of running and clearly had an off day.
Divertimenti, allowed a soft lead when beating Count Ceprano here last time, could never get anywhere near the front this time and, forced wide on the home turn, he was soon beaten.
